Creeping Charlie, ground ivy, gill-on-the-ground, creeping Jenny – it doesn’t matter what name you call it, this is a weed that’s difficult to control. Glechoma hederacea is a perennial weed in the mint family that spreads by seeds, rhizomes and creeping stems that root at the nodes. The organic arsenicals (DSMA, MSMA, AMA, etc.) are primarily used to control summer grassy weeds such as crabgrass, Dallisgrass, foxtails, goosegrass, nutsedge (a grass-like weed), and sandbur soon after their emergence in May and June. These postemergence herbicides are selective and slightly systemic.

How to get rid of the worst lawn weeds in NZ without harming your lawn. …Factor 3) fall is an ideal time to control the majority of winter annual broadleaf weeds that emerge from September through mid-October. Plants such as henbit/deadnettle, chickweeds, Carolina geranium, and buttercup are prominent winter annual broadleaf weeds that can easily be controlled by herbicides when they are young and actively growing.Weed control products work by interfering with weed growth either by blocking photosynthesis and protein production or by destroying or inhibiting root formation. Weed control products may be post-emergent or pre-emergent and are applied at different times for different purposes. Pre-emergents are applied to the soil before weeds even emerge.

Prevention. The best defense against weeds is a thick lawn that is properly cared for, well-fed and never scalped by mowing. A thick lawn will be better able to choke out weeds and not allow them room to establish.
